public class DockableStateWillChangeEvent
extends java.lang.Object
Events are triggered when a component is :
Note that event are not triggered by drag-dock moves (they don't correspond to a state change). If you need to track such changes, use a Swing AncestorListener, or override the addNotify method of your dockable component.
It is also possible to track changes after they occur with the DockableStateChangeEvent .
AncestorListener
,
DockableStateWillChangeListener
Constructor and Description |
---|
DockableStateWillChangeEvent(DockableState currentState,
DockableState futureState) |
Modifier and Type | Method and Description |
---|---|
void |
cancel()
Refuse the change of dockable state.
|
DockableState |
getCurrentState()
this method will return null when the event is triggered for initial docking
|
DockableState |
getFutureState()
Returns the future (proposed) state of the dockable.
|
boolean |
isAccepted() |
public DockableStateWillChangeEvent(DockableState currentState, DockableState futureState)
public DockableState getCurrentState()
public DockableState getFutureState()
cancel()
public void cancel()
The docking action is cancelled.
public boolean isAccepted()
Copyright © 2010-2014 Pacific Biosciences. All Rights Reserved.